The rapid evolution of digital tools has significantly boosted the need for experts in online and social communication. Mastering digital platforms and social networks is now essential for success in diverse fields, including media, marketing, policy development, and advocacy.
This program equips you with the expertise to become a skilled digital communicator. You'll gain advanced capabilities in developing, sustaining, and overseeing web-based communications across various platforms, including digital publishing, online collaboration, and virtual community building.
The curriculum covers core principles of digital communication, teaching you to recognize and analyze emerging phenomena like AI, influencer marketing, data analytics, and digital metrics.
You'll examine how digital transformation is revolutionizing governance, culture, and business, and learn to implement these insights in professional settings. Specialized study options include communications policy, digital content strategy, and professional training methods.
Your final year includes an independent research project culminating in a thesis. Graduates may qualify for PhD programs, with options to complete the course earlier at graduate diploma or certificate levels.
Specifically, applicants require a 3 or 4 year bachelor degree in any field from a recognised tertiary education institution OR successful completion of 2 or more units in the Graduate Certificate in Digital and Social Media. Students who have completed more than 50 credits of Digital and Social Media or Internet Communications undergraduate units, or any previous versions at Curtin University are not eligible for entry to this course.
Certificate in Advanced English (CAE): Grade C; and Pearson Test of English Academic: 60. IELTS (International English Language Testing System) -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king - 6.0; Overall band score 6.5; T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) 79 (overall) Reading 13 Listening 13 Speaking 18 Writing 21.
